[FR] Comment mettre sa clef DigiSpark en azerty

Bonjour,

Déjà merci de votre présence ici :D.

Je vient car je débute et j'ai une clef usb digispark

C'est celle ci .

Le problème est que lorsque que je souhaite émuler un clavier il l'émule en qwerty :confused:

Par exemple.

Digikeyboard.print("azerty");

va sortir comme sa

qwerty

Il est donc extrêmement difficile de coder tranquillement :confused:

Si vous savez comment réglés ce problème je suis preneur.

Cordialement

Melv1no:
Bonjour,

Déjà merci de votre présence ici :D.

Je vient car je débute et j'ai une clef usb digispark

C'est celle ci .

Le problème est que lorsque que je souhaite émuler un clavier il l'émule en qwerty :confused:

Par exemple.

Digikeyboard.print("azerty");

va sortir comme sa

qwerty

Il est donc extrêmement difficile de coder tranquillement :confused:

Si vous savez comment réglés ce problème je suis preneur.

Cordialement

Bonsoir
lire tout ce topic

Merci beaucoup je vais voir sa de suite :smiley:

Hey me revoilà, dans le topic que tu m'as envoyé j'ai ce message -->

j'ai  trouvé ceci
il semble que tu doives définir dire à la librairie quel clavier tu utilises
 avant d'inclure la librairie.


"
#define kbd_tr_tr
#include "DigiKeyboard.h"

You can use:

    kbd_tr_tr
    kbd_be_be
    kbd_cz_cz
    kbd_da_dk
    kbd_de_de
    kbd_en_us
    kbd_es_es
    kbd_fi_fi
    kbd_fr_fr
    kbd_it_it
    kbd_pt_pt
"

tu dois donc avoir en tête de ton prg

#define kbd_fr_fr
#include "DigiKeyboard.h"

Le seul problème c'est que lorsque que je fait exactement sa ne fonctionne il y a une erreur ...

Exemple -->

#define kbd_fr_fr
#include "DigiKeyboard.h"


void Setup(){
  
}
void loop(){
  DigiKeyboard.print("a");
}

Donc l'or de la compilation voici l'erreur lettre pour lettre.

Arduino : 1.8.10 (Windows 10), Carte : "Digispark (Default - 16.5mhz)"

core\core.a(main.cpp.o): In function `main':

C:\Users****\AppData\Local\Arduino15\packages\digistump\hardware\avr\1.6.7\cores\tiny/main.cpp:7: undefined reference to `setup'

collect2.exe: error: ld returned 1 exit status

Plusieurs bibliothèque trouvées pour "DigiKeyboard.h"
Utilisé : C:\Users\Brevet
exit status 1
Erreur de compilation pour la carte Digispark (Default - 16.5mhz)

Ce rapport pourrait être plus détaillé avec
l'option "Afficher les résultats détaillés de la compilation"
activée dans Fichier -> Préférences.

Je ne sais pas si c'était sa qu'il fallait faire mais j'ai trouver seulement sa.

Merci

undefined reference to `setup'

tu as utilisé Setup() dans ton code au lieu de setup()

Exacte mais sa ne marche pas c'est toujour en qwerty :,(

Vous pourriez m'aidez ?,